BCCI President Sourav Ganguly was recently engaged in a public banter with his daughter Sana after she took a potshot at his mood in a photo posted from inside Eden Gardens. On that occasion, Sourav had left his daughter speechless after she teased him about his grumpy mood while posing for the camera. Days later, Sourav has decided to tease Sana with his cheeky one-liner.

Sourav Ganguly

Sourav took to Instagram to post a photo of Sana with the family’s pet dog. His cheeky caption read, “Sana and sugar … sugar much easier to deal with.”

No sooner did the former India captain share the Instagram post, his fans began to appreciate him for his quirky caption. One wrote, “Your sense of humor is epic…” Another commented, “Hahahaha ! That can only be said by a dad !” “What a witty caption dada,” commented another fan.

Last month, Sourav and Sana were engaged in public banter after Sana pulled her Dad’s leg by commenting on his seemingly grumpy mood in a photo taken from inside Eden Gardens soon after India defeated Bangladesh in their first-ever pink-ball Test. Sana, who recently celebrated her 18th birthday, had asked Sourav why he was looking grumpy in his photo. The father came up with an equally witty response, declaring his daughter ‘disobedient.’

Speaking at a conclave by India Today in Kolkata on Friday, Sourav said that opting for the day-night Test match made common sense. “Test cricket needs to be marketed well. Also I feel it’s about time. People do not have time to watch Test cricket in the morning. It came out from common sense,” Ganguly was quoted as saying.

Sourav is married to classical dancer Dona Ganguly, who gave birth to Sana in 2001. Sourav is credited with bringing about the revolution in Indian cricket by leading the team to start winning on foreign soil. He was recently elected as the BCCI President unopposed.
